The Kosovo government has not yet approved the budget for marking the 10th anniversary of independence. This is also jeopardizing the arrival of Rita Ora, world - renowned singer and Kosovo descent.
President Thaci's adviser, Adil Behramaj, who is part of the Organisation's Committee Council for the Independence Anniversary, has reconfirmed the willingness of singer Rita Ora to sing on February 17th in Pristina.
“Budget is just a procedure issue, which we believe will be approved next week. We've been in touch with Rita's team and family all this time, and yesterday we've been reconfirmed that Rita and her team are ready to come to Pristina for the 10th anniversary of independence, for Kosovo and our citizens. A concert of a world star like Rita, of course, has expenses, and no local company has the capacity to organise it without co-operation with other regional companies. Rita, I repeat, is coming for citizens and has demanded that the entire concert be opened, without tickets, without looking at”, he told Express.
We as the Organising Council, which we've been in the composition of all the highest institutions in the country, have done our job, while now the decision-making is in the hands of executive institutions, which have their own procedures”, Behrahaj said further.
